After Penn. State Scandal, La. Bill Would Require Reporting Of Child Abuse
A New Orleans state senator wants to toughen Louisiana law that requires people to report child abuse, in response to the allegations of sexual abuse of boys involving a former Penn State University assistant football coach.

Louisiana Classic champs across here
St. Paul’s wrestlers senior Chris Arms and junior Connor Campo kept their unbeaten streaks alive at the Louisiana Classic Wrestling Tournament held last weekend in Baton Rouge. Arms (52-0) captured the 170-pound title, while Campo (45-0) took the 126-pound crown helping the Wolves to an eighth place finish (116) in the 39-team field.
